Re: Omega B FL types of automatic gearboxes
« Reply #3 on: 26 February 2011, 21:12:19 »

I don't think any of the cars sold here in the UK had the 5L40E. I think the AR25 and AR35 are variations of the 4L30E.

There was a thread on here a while ago about an Opel fitted with the 5L40E.
